Transaction dd5895988e884f2a0af74440f098adba7fee85a5aec60eaa5c73c528df828884
1 Input
1 Output
-
dd5895988e884f2a0af74440f098adba7fee85a5aec60eaa5c73c528df828884:0
- value
- 2715736
- script pubkey
- OP_0 OP_PUSHBYTES_32 e6fbe8f512351492475c4e20e7afeabd900c9ffbe566a0993ff2921ec38556d6
- address
- bc1quma73agjx52fy36ufcsw0tl2hkgqe8lmu4n2pxfl72fpasu92mtqrqd6al